Hello first off I have a 1990 Eagle Talon Tsi Awd 5 speed.
I searched for similar threads and could not find anything. Can anyone help lead me in the right direction. My running lights are stuck on even with no key in as well as headlights off. Also when i turn the key my windshield wipers are always on as well. Im thinking its a short have anyone experienced anything like this or can anyone help lead me in the right direction.

Sounds like you have a short, or possibly a blown connection on a circuit board thats causing the lights and wipers to stay on. Reason I say that is because it sounds like you can not turn off the power to these things which means a "switch" is broken.

Did you try to take out the fuses and put them back? I had this happen on a radio issue on my BMW and oddly enough fixed it.
 
Canadian 1g's have a DRL (daytime running light) circuit board that kicks on the lights whenever the car is on, it seems yours are ALWAYS on though or is yours somehow a CANADIAN DSM?

So basically you've got to unplug that battery to shutoff your running lights. The windshield controls and headlight controls are on separate switches but both are on the steering wheel column. If it were my issue I'd pull apart the steering wheel column and make sure those hand switches are still working. They are plastic inside so if it breaks it will close the circuit and keep whatever it is "ON". I had a similar issue with my left blinker, the damn thing would shutoff until I replaced the hand switch on the column.
